White Oak Floor Installation Questions
What types of white oak flooring are available for installation? White oak flooring options include solid, engineered, and unfinished or pre-finished planks to suit different preferences and project needs.
Can white oak flooring be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, white oak flooring can often be installed over existing wood or suitable subflooring, depending on the condition and type of the current surface.
What preparations are needed before installing white oak flooring? Proper subfloor preparation, moisture assessment, and acclimation of the wood are important steps to ensure a successful installation.
What are common installation methods for white oak flooring? White oak flooring can be installed using nail-down, glue-down, or floating methods, depending on the type of flooring and the subfloor.
